What does mehrabani means in English?

"Mehrabani" is a Hindi word that has multiple meanings in English, depending on the context. Here are some of the most common translations:

* Kindness: This is the most common and general meaning. It conveys a sense of goodwill, generosity, and helpfulness.

* Favor: This emphasizes the act of doing something for someone else, often out of the ordinary.

* Courtesy: This implies politeness and consideration for others.

* Grace: This emphasizes the act of being merciful or forgiving.

The specific meaning of "mehrabani" will depend on the situation and the tone of voice.

Here are some examples:

* "Thank you for your mehrabani." This would translate to "Thank you for your kindness" or "Thank you for your favor."

* "He showed me great mehrabani." This could be translated as "He was very kind to me" or "He did me a great favor."

* "Please accept my mehrabani." This would translate to "Please accept my courtesy" or "Please accept my grace."

In general, "mehrabani" is a positive and respectful term that is often used to express gratitude or appreciation.
